- BrainChip Holdings Ltd is a technology company specializing in the development and commercialization of neuromorphic art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) hardware and software solutions. Its core products include the Akida neuromorphic processor IP, the 2nd Generation Akida platform, the Akida1000 reference system on chip (SoC), MetaTF development environment for spiking neural network (SNN) training and deployment, and Akida enablement platforms such as PCIe boards, Edge AI boxes, and development kits compatible with shuttle PCs and Raspberry Pi devices. The company’s technology provides ultra-low power AI edge networks designed for vision, audio, olfactory, and smart transducer applications across diverse industries including manufacturing, defense, oil and gas, power generation, and water treatment. BrainChip operates globally, with engineering and development expertise located in California, Toulouse (France), and Hyderabad (India), and is publicly traded on the Australian Stock Exchange (BRN:ASX) and OTC Markets (BRCHF).
Founded in 2004 and headquartered in Sydney, Australia, BrainChip has made significant strides recently through major strategic moves. In 2024 and 2025, the company secured substantial funding rounds totaling up to A$37 million through placements and share purchase plans to support ongoing product development and commercialization efforts. BrainChip formed a strategic partnership with Blue Ridge Envisioneering (BRE), a Parsons Company, to integrate its Akida neuromorphic processors into edge AI defense systems, enhancing adaptive performance in constrained environments. Additionally, BrainChip expanded its ecosystem with alliances such as the collaboration with Edge Impulse to leverage Akida’s neuromorphic capabilities in advanced machine learning applications, and with Ai Labs to scale high-end vision and multi-sensory device capabilities. It has also bolstered its intellectual property portfolio with new patents and applications to protect and extend its technology leadership in neuromorphic computing.
The company targets technology sectors requiring energy-efficient AI processing at the edge, including industrial IoT, automotive, smart sensors, and defense systems across North America, Oceania, Europe, the Middle East, and Asia. Its offerings address complex AI processing challenges, enabling devices to perform AI inference with low power consumption and offline capabilities. BrainChip’s latest product innovations focus on enhancing event-based and neuromorphic processing for complex neural network models, further differentiating it in the AI semiconductor market. The firm maintains a strong focus on research and development, supported by a reconstituted Scientific Advisory Board and experienced leadership team to drive next-generation edge AI innovations.
